Musk's Mega-Merge: SpaceX, Tesla, xAI Unite? Implications for AI and Automation
The potential merger of SpaceX, Tesla, and xAI, a strategic alignment of Elon Musk's groundbreaking companies, presents a fascinating prospect for the future of AI and automation. Impact on the Tech Landscape
A merger of this magnitude would have a profound impact on the tech landscape:
* Increased Competition: The merged company would become a major force in the AI, robotics, and space exploration industries, putting pressure on existing players. Traditional aerospace companies, automotive manufacturers, and AI research labs would all need to adapt to compete with the new powerhouse.
* Accelerated Innovation: The combined resources and talent of the three companies would likely lead to an acceleration of innovation in these fields. We could see breakthroughs in AI, robotics, space travel, and sustainable energy sooner than previously expected.
* New Business Models: The merger could also lead to the development of new business models that are not currently possible. For example, the company could offer AI-powered services to other businesses or governments, or it could develop new space-based products and services.
* Ethical Considerations: A company with this much power and influence would need to be carefully regulated to ensure that its technologies are used responsibly and ethically. Issues such as AI bias, data privacy, and the potential for misuse of robotics would need to be addressed.

Potential Challenges and Risks
While the potential benefits of a merger are significant, there are also several challenges and risks to consider:
* Integration Challenges: Integrating three very different companies with distinct cultures and processes would be a complex undertaking. Cultural clashes and integration difficulties could hinder the realization of synergies.
* Regulatory Scrutiny: A merger of this magnitude would likely face intense regulatory scrutiny from antitrust authorities around the world. Regulators may be concerned about the potential for the merged company to stifle competition.
* Management Challenges: Managing a company with such a diverse range of businesses and technologies would be a significant challenge for Elon Musk and his leadership team. The company would need to develop a clear strategic vision and effective governance structures.
* Over-Diversification: Spreading resources across too many disparate areas can lead to lack of focus and ultimately underperformance in all areas.
